The properties and formation of nanotubes have been extensively studied, bu
t very few deal with the catalytic production mechanism of nanotubes. Two d
ifferent techniques, thermogravimetric analysis and UV-Raman, have been app
lied to analyse the carbon deposition by catalysed decomposition of acetyle
ne over an iron-based catalyst. The nature of the produced carbon materials
depends on reaction temperature. Also, TEM allows identification of carbon
nanotubes, encapsulated particles, and other nanostructures, while UV-Rama
n confirms its graphitic and graphite-like nature. (C) 2000 Elsevier Scienc
